True animal sanctuaries typically don’t have babies. This is because animal breeding and exploitation are closely linked. Babies are bred to drive milk production, ticket sales, or to produce an animal “product.” Noah was a product of unchecked breeding and the first priority we addressed when converting Freedom Farms into a sanctuary. Noah is Freedom Farms’ first and last baby cow!



Noah is cherished by his mom and every human he meets. Sadly, male calves born on farms aren’t so lucky. They are routinely taken from their mothers almost immediately after being born, destined for horrific ends at slaughterhouses. Often, these babies live out their short lives in confined pens and are killed to be consumed as veal.
